How 2029063 is built
A Julian date in the day-of-year sense is just the year followed by the
day number, counted from 1 January. March 4, 2029 is the
63rd day of 2029, so the code is
2029 + 063 = 2029063.
Many systems drop the century and print 29063 instead.
2029 is a common year with 365 days, so day numbers run from 001 to 365. After March 4, 2029 there are 302 days left in the year.
Careful: 29063 does not name a century
The 5-digit form 29063 only carries two digits of
year, so on its own it is ambiguous. Day 63 of a year ending
in 29 could equally be:
- March 4, 2029 — the usual reading for a recent product code
- March 4, 1929
- March 4, 2129
If you are reading a code off packaging, the surrounding context — a shelf life of months rather than decades — almost always settles it.
Day 63 in nearby years
The same day number lands on a different calendar date depending on whether the year is a leap year. This is the single most common mistake when decoding a code whose year you had to guess.
| Year | Julian date | Calendar date |
|---|---|---|
| 2026 | 2026063 | March 4, 2026 |
| 2027 | 2027063 | March 4, 2027 |
| 2028 | 2028063 | March 3, 2028 |
| 2029 | 2029063 | March 4, 2029 |
| 2030 | 2030063 | March 4, 2030 |
| 2031 | 2031063 | March 4, 2031 |
| 2032 | 2032063 | March 3, 2032 |
Astronomical Julian Date for March 4, 2029
In astronomy, "Julian Date" means something different: a continuous count of days since noon on 1 January 4713 BC. The Julian Day Number for March 4, 2029 is 2462200 — that number covers the 24 hours from noon UTC on March 4, 2029 to noon UTC the next day.
- JD at 00:00 UTC —
2462199.5 - JD at 12:00 UTC —
2462200.0 - Modified Julian Date (MJD) at 00:00 UTC —
62199.0
